Preferred Label : Enteric-Coated Zoledronic Acid Tablet MER-101;
NCIt synonyms : Zoledronic Acid Tablet; Oral Zoledronic Acid;
NCIt definition : An oral tablet formulation containing zoledronic acid combined with a proprietary
absorption enhancer for improved zoledronic acid gastrointestinal absorption with
anti-bone-resorption activity. The third-generation bisphosphonate zoledronic acid
binds to hydroxyapatite crystals in the bone matrix, slowing their dissolution and
inhibiting the formation and aggregation of these crystals. This agent also inhibits
farnesyl pyrophosphate synthase, an enzyme involved in terpenoid biosynthesis. Inhibition
of this enzyme prevents the biosynthesis of isoprenoid lipids, donor substrates of
farnesylation and geranylgeranylation during the post-translational modification of
small GTPase signalling proteins, which are important in the process of osteoclast
turnover. The proprietary absorption enhancer is a GRAS (generally-recognized-as-safe)
food additive.;
